Okay then the likes, the gameplay is pretty good, it's your standard sidescroller get from point A to point B, but what helps to make this gameplay stand out is the fact that we can do close quarters and long-range combat.
The pixel Graphics art style is really good it captures the feel of classic side scrollers from back in the day, with its rich use of colors, it's visuals, it's designs and nicely detailed environments, its vary nostalgic and you can tell the creators really wanted to capture that feeling of older style games.
Complementing the visuals is a lively soundtrack that maintains a sense of momentum throughout the adventure.
You can play with a gamepad (which I strongly recommend) or with your keyboard.
